Transaction d6dc17af95f7ac733b9779f15b3d8f90b298ce7637112b39342123ac52f81e9a
1 Input
1 Output
-
d6dc17af95f7ac733b9779f15b3d8f90b298ce7637112b39342123ac52f81e9a:0
- value
- 17738372
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b4e0fe16a601524be72a7cf78459498830f6498
- address
- bc1qhd8qlct2vq2jf0nj5l8hs3v5nzps7eycxtrnq8